Yesterday at 02:55
Former Scotland and British and Irish Lions head coach Sir Ian McGeechan says he has been diagnosed with prostate cancer.
Yesterday at 02:55
Former Scotland and British and Irish Lions head coach Sir Ian McGeechan says he has been diagnosed with prostate cancer.
Top 5 Home
7.